Apollo Group Earnings Review: 20 Days after Announcement Shares Up 9.6% (APOL)
Comtex SmarTrend(R) - Mon Nov 10, 12:15PM CST
20 days ago, on October 21st, 2014, Apollo Group (NASDAQ:APOL) reported its earnings. Analysts, on average, expected earnings of $0.27 per share on sales of $730.1 million. Apollo Group actually reported earnings of $0.34 per share on sales of $709.7 million, beating EPS estimates by $0.07 and missing revenue estimates by $20.4 million. Shares of Apollo Group have climbed from $26.87 to $29.44, representing a gain of 9.6% since the company reported earnings 20 days ago.

Employment Outlook for Service Members Continues to Improve, But Translating Skills to Civilian Jobs Still a Challenge for Many Veterans, Reveals University of Phoenix Survey
Business Wire - Mon Nov 10, 9:30AM CST
A new University of Phoenix national military survey suggests that while the veteran unemployment rate continues to declinei, many veterans may actually be underemployed. A majority (61 percent) of past service members who have held civilian jobs say they have previously been or currently are in jobs beneath their skill sets, with nearly three-quarters (72 percent) saying they accepted a position because they were unemployed and needed a job. Forty-two percent of past service members who are currently employed say they are working in jobs today that are beneath their skill sets.
